Pat Oliphant : The New York Times calls him "the most influential cartoonist now working". He is an Australian-born political cartooning legend, and he’s back in town with a gold-mine of observations, opinions and advice. A Pulitzer Prize winner and twice a Reuben Award winner, he continues to spark debate and remains a steadfast force in world political thinking. Miss this at your peril.
